Synopsis by Hans J. Wollstein
An otherwise honest gambler, played by Jack Holt, begins to cheat at cards in order to put his son John Darrow through mining school in this lavish Zane Grey adaptation produced by Paramount. The callow foster-son pays back the noble gesture by running off with Holt's mistress, Olga Baclanova. They are stopped by the avalanche of the title and the forgiving Holt manages to rescue both their lives. While acknowledging that Olga Baclanova of the Moscow Art Theater was slightly out of place in this rough and tumble Western melodrama, the trade-paper Variety praised her performance as one of the main reasons for the film's success.
